News Feed
Back to ForumLee replied to "Ability to add multiple styles"
Add a style. Within that style there should be:
Templates including any template modifications (future feature) which could also be per style.
CSS
Images/Assets
Fav Icon?
Styles should be:
Default selected from ACP
Users can choose their own style (permission gated: can_choose_style)
Settable per node
Settable per usergroup
User specific styles should be editable in the ACP + Moderator Panel
Usergroup permission gated
Does this about sum it up?
Lee replied to "Weighting to ranks"
Admin Weight: 100
Moderator Weight: 75
User Weight: 50
Styling should be applied by greatest weight first, UNLESS an option "make priority styling" option is checked.
Crystal replied to "Weighting to ranks"
Sounds like a plan! I'm sure we'll find the right solution :)
Lee replied to "Weighting to ranks"
I like the sound of this.
We should use integers to achieve this.
Weighting to ranks
For users with multiple ranks, we should add a weighting to ranks so it's obvious which one takes precedence for stylistic purposes if someone customizes the look of a group's usernames or badges. Does Admin outweigh Moderator? Does Moderator outweigh Member? Does Premium Member outweigh Member? Does Banned? Things like that, just so when someone shows up in multiple groups the right styling or badge is displayed.
Crystal replied to "Auto-parse smilies/emotes"
Noticed some are missing, maybe a browser issue?

Ability to add multiple styles
One thing we should add is the ability to add multiple styles so we can show off multiple style options and, eventually, different looks for the software, as well.
Simple for now -- multiple style sheets for customization and selection.
Ideally down the line we'll see ways to streamline style and template modification to create dynamic looks, but to start with, just the ability to have multiple styles would be a great start so sites can offer options.
More complex later -- Customizable templating system to help create dynamic looks for the various parts of the site. Index/forum list, thread list, messages, conversations, calendar, acp, usercp, profiles, all of it. Let's make Serenity truly customizable so anyone can take it and make it whatever they want it to be.
Crystal replied to "Auto-parse smilies/emotes"
One step forward! Auto parsing will come :)
Lee replied to "Auto-parse smilies/emotes"
π
Editor drop down still works.
Lee replied to "Auto-parse smilies/emotes"
:D
Seems auto parse has rolled back in this revision.
Crystal replied to "User Tagging & Mentions"
@Lee I would indeed agree :)
Lee replied to "User Tagging & Mentions"
@Crystal I think you would agree, this is implemented? ;)
Lee replied to "Passwordless Authentication Flow & 2FA/Passkeys"
This is now implemented in the next version.
Lee replied to "Javascript has not updated upon upgrade"
This bug report has been marked as resolved in version 1.0.0 Alpha 1.
Lee replied to "Uploading an attachment and inserting it in to a post does not work"
This bug report has been marked as resolved.
Thread filtering
Should be able to filter and sort threads per node.
Order By
Sort by prefix
Sort by thread type
Sort by unread/read
Sort by unanswered/answered
Sort by Author
Email fails to send
Sending the test email from the ACP fails, atleast using the mail() feature.
Check others for operation.
Javascript has not updated upon upgrade
The javascript for paste to upload has not imported upon upgrade.
Additionally, the Javascript for mentions also has not imported on upgrade.
